@charset "utf-8";
body{ padding:0; margin:0 auto; font:12px/18px "宋体"; color:#333333;}
ol, ul, dl, dt, dd{ padding:0px; margin:0px;}
li{ list-style:none;}
img{ border:none; border:0;}
a{ text-decoration:none; color:#333333; noline: expression(this.onFocus=this.blur());}
a:focus {outline:none;-moz-outline:none;}
a:hover{text-decoration:none; color:#cc3300;}
.clear{clear:both;}
.fl{float:left;}
.fr{float:right;}

.space10{height:10px; line-height:10px; overflow:hidden; font-size:0; clear:both;}
.space15{height:15px; line-height:10px; overflow:hidden; font-size:0; clear:both;}
.w980{ width:980px; margin:0 auto;}


/*top*/
.top_box{ height:277px;}
.top{ height:75px; background:url(/global-gzlry/top.jpg) no-repeat center top; padding-top:202px;}
.mainanv{ background:#fff; height:75px; overflow:hidden;}
.mainanv .nav_box{height:41px;}
.mainanv .nav_l, .mainanv .nav_r{float:left; width:6px; height:41px; background:url(/global-gzlry/mainnav_edge.gif) no-repeat;}
.mainanv .nav_r{float:right; background-position:-6px 0;}
.mainanv .nav{background:url(/global-gzlry/mainnav_bg.gif) repeat-x; height:41px; padding-left:12px; width:956px; float:left;}
.mainanv .nav li{float:left; width:9%; text-align:center;}
.mainanv .nav li a{display:inline-block; height:33px; line-height:33px; color:#fff; font-size:15px; margin-top:4px; font-family:"微软雅黑"; padding:0 2px;}
.mainanv .nav li.active a{ background:url(/global-gzlry/icon1.gif) no-repeat center bottom; border-bottom:#fff 1px solid;}

.mainanv .subnav, .mainanv .top_infor{ height:34px; background:url(/global-gzlry/subnav_bg.gif) repeat-x; line-height:34px; clear:both; font-size:14px;}
.top_infor .search{ float:right; padding:6px 10px 0 0; width:233px;}
.top_infor .search .searchTxt{float:left; width:162px; height:21px; line-height:21px; padding:0 5px 0 23px; color:#999999; border:#ccc 1px solid; background:url(/global-gzlry/icon_search.gif) no-repeat 4px center #fff; border-right:none;}
.top_infor .search .searchBtn{float:right; width:42px; height:23px; background:url(/global-gzlry/btn_search.gif) no-repeat; cursor:pointer; border:0; color:#993333;}
.mainanv .subnav{padding-left:28px;}

/*bottom*/
.bottom_box{ height:95px;}
.bottom{width:980px; margin:0 auto; clear:both; height:56px; padding-top:13px; text-align:center; line-height:22px; background:url(/global-gzlry/bot_line.gif) repeat-x;}


/*home*/
/*home*/
.home_tpxw{float:left; width:375px; height:301px; position:relative; overflow:hidden; }
.home_tpxw img{width:100%; height:301px; display:block;}
.home_tpxw .bd li{ position:relative; overflow:hidden; zoom:1;}
.home_tpxw .bd .txtbg{position:absolute; bottom:0; _bottom:-1px; left:0; width:100%; height:40px; background:#000; filter:alpha(opacity=50); -moz-opacity: 0.5; opacity:0.5;}
.home_tpxw .bd .txt{position:absolute; bottom:0; left:15px; right:100px; color:#fff; font-size:14px; line-height:40px; white-space:nowrap; text-overflow:ellipsis; -o-text-overflow:ellipsis; overflow:hidden;}
.home_tpxw .hd{ position:absolute; bottom:15px; right:15px;}
.home_tpxw .hd li{float:left; width:10px; height:10px; margin-left:5px; line-height:0; overflow:hidden; font-size:0; background:#eaeaea; border-radius:50%; -moz-border-radius:50%; -o-border-radius:50%; -webkit-border-radius:50%; cursor:pointer;}
.home_tpxw .hd li.on{background:#d82225;}
.home_tpxw .bd ul, .home_tpxw .bd li{width:100% !important;}

.home_news{float:left; width:342px; height:301px; margin-left:10px;}
.home_news .tab{ height:38px;}
.home_news .tab li{float:left;}
.home_news .tab li a{ display:block; color:#333333; font-size:16px; width:169px; height:36px; line-height:36px; font-family:"微软雅黑"; font-weight:bold; text-align:center; background:url(/global-gzlry/home_tab.gif) repeat-x 0 -36px; border:#cccccc 1px solid;}
.home_news .tab li.active a{border:#e4251c 1px solid; background-position:0 0; color:#fff;}
.home_news .cont{clear:both; border:#ccc 1px solid; border-top:none; height:263px;}
.home_news .cont h5{ font-size:14px; padding:14px 0 6px; margin:0; text-align:center;}
.home_news .cont h5 a{color:#cc3300;}
.home_news .cont p{ margin:0 5px; border-bottom:#ccc 1px dashed; padding:0 6px; line-height:24px; color:#666666; height:86px;}
.home_news .cont p a{color:#ff0000;}
.home_news .cont ul{padding:8px 0 0 17px; }
.home_news .cont ul li{ line-height:30px; font-size:14px; line-height:30px;}

.home_byjj{float:right; width:244px; height:301px; background:url(/global-gzlry/home_byjj_bg.gif) repeat-x; border:#ccc 1px solid;}
.home_byjj .name{ background:url(/global-gzlry/icon2.gif) no-repeat 12px center; padding-left:30px; font-size:16px; font-family:"微软雅黑"; color:#cc0000; line-height:40px; margin:5px 0;}
.home_byjj .pic{text-align:center;}
.home_byjj .pic img{width:230px; height:92px; display: block; margin: auto;}
.home_byjj p{line-height:26px; padding:5px 10px 0px; margin:0; text-indent:2em;}
.home_byjj p a{color:#ff0000;}
.home_byjj .tel{ height:53px; background:url(/global-gzlry/tel.jpg) no-repeat 10px 0;}
.home_byjj .btn{padding-left:12px;}
.home_byjj .btn a{ display:inline-block; width:118px; height:42px; text-align:center; line-height:42px; font-size:16px; font-family:"微软雅黑"; color:#fff; background:url(/global-gzlry/btn1.jpg) no-repeat; margin:0 7px;}
.home_byjj .btn a.a02{background-position:-118px 0;}

.home_scroll{height:145px; background:#efefef;}
.home_scroll #ISL_Cont{float:left; margin-left:10px;}
.home_scroll ul li{padding:13px 14px 0; float:left; background:url(/global-gzlry/home_picbg.jpg) no-repeat center bottom; height:116px;}
.home_scroll ul li .txt{ width:247px; font-size:14px; height:39px; line-height:39px; text-align:center; background:#fff; border:#ccc 1px solid; border-top:none; font-size:15px; font-family:"微软雅黑";}
.home_scroll ul li img, .home_scroll ul li .picture{ width:263px; height:116px; background:#fff;}
.home_scroll .LeftArrow, .home_scroll .RightArrow{ width:44px; height:145px; cursor:pointer; background:url(/global-gzlry/icon_scroll.gif) center center no-repeat #dadada; _display:inline;}
.home_scroll .LeftArrow{float:left; background-position:0px 50px;}
.home_scroll .RightArrow{float:right; background-position:-42px 50px;}

.home_ryzy{ margin-right:8px;}
.home_box1{float:left; width:319px; height:288px; border:#ccc 1px solid;}
.home_box1 .name{height:38px; background:url(/global-gzlry/home_titlebg1.gif) repeat-x; border-bottom:#ccc 1px solid;}
.home_box1 .name h3{ float:left; padding:0 12px; line-height:38px; height:39px; background:#fff; margin:0; color:#cc0000; font-size:15px; font-family:"微软雅黑"; border-right:#ccc 1px solid;}
.home_box1 .txt{ padding:15px 15px; font-size:14px; line-height:30px;}
.home_box1 .txt a{color:#ff0000;}
.home_map{float:right; width:319px; border:#ccc 1px solid; height:288px;}



/*列表页*/
.main_t, .main_b{ width:988px; margin:0 auto; height:6px; line-height:6px; overflow:hidden; zoom:1; font-size:0;}
.main_t{background:url(/global-gzlry/main_t.gif) repeat-y;}
.main_b{background:url(/global-gzlry/main_b.gif) repeat-y;}
.main{ width:980px; margin:0 auto; clear:both; padding:0 4px; background:url(/global-gzlry/main_c.gif) repeat-y;}
.sidebar{ float:left; width:246px; padding:0 1px; margin-top:-2px; _position:relative;}
.sidebar .name{ height:47px; background:#cc0000; text-align:center; line-height:47px; margin:0; color:#fff; font-size:18px; font-family:"微软雅黑";}
.sidebar ul{padding:2px;}
.sidebar ul li a{ display:block; line-height:34px; border-bottom:#ccc 1px solid; background:url(/global-gzlry/icon_sidebar1.gif) no-repeat 10px 12px #f8f8f8; padding:5px 10px 5px 32px; font-size:16px; font-family:"微软雅黑"; color:#999999;}
.sidebar ul li a:hover, .sidebar ul li a.aon{background:url(/global-gzlry/icon_sidebar2.gif) no-repeat 10px 12px #f8f8f8; color:#cc0000;}

.mainContent{float:right; width:724px;}
.current{margin:0 15px; border-bottom:#cccccc 3px solid; line-height:44px; height:44px; padding-top:4px; _overflow:hidden;}
.current h3{margin:0; float:left; padding:0 10px 0 5px; border-bottom:#cc0000 3px solid; height:44px; font-family:"微软雅黑"; font-size:20px; _position:relative; color:#cc0000;}
.current .curb{ float:right; color:#666666; font-size:12px;}
.current .curb a{color:#666666;}
.list_tt{ font-size:14px; line-height:26px; padding:10px 15px;}

.news_list{ clear:both; padding:10px 20px;}
.news_list ul{ padding:15px 30px 0;}
.news_list li{line-height:40px; font-size:14px;}
.news_list li span{float:right;}

.pagediv{ clear:both; padding:30px 0; text-align:center; font-size:14px; overflow:hidden;}
#pagination_input{width:40px; margin:0 3px;}
.pagediv .arrow{margin:0 3px;}

/*内容页*/
.curb_info{ line-height:34px; padding-left:24px; width:956px; margin:0 auto;}
.main2{ width:978px; margin:0 auto; border:#ccc 1px solid;}
.news_info{padding:0 44px;}
.info_title{ margin:0; font-size:20px; color:#cc0000; font-family:"微软雅黑"; padding:32px 0 12px; text-align:center; line-height:26px;}
.info_fbt{ text-align:center; font-size:14px; color:#999999; padding-bottom:35px; border-bottom:#9d9d9d 1px dotted;}
.info_cont{ line-height:36px; font-size:14px; padding:25px 0 44px;}

.l{width:200px; position:fixed; top:280px; right:32px; z-index:999; _POSITION: absolute;}
.l img{ border:none;}
#float span{text-align:right;}

/**归档*/
.guidang{position: absolute; right: 2%; top: 30px; width: 258px;  height: 104px; background: url(/global-gzlry/gd.png) no-repeat;
  z-index: 999;}
.guidang span{display: block; padding: 4px 0 0 116px;  color: #c81208; font-size:1.6em; font-weight: bold; transform:rotate(-2deg); 
  -ms-transform:rotate(-2deg); 	/* IE 9 */
  -moz-transform:rotate(-2deg); 	/* Firefox */
  -webkit-transform:rotate(-2deg); /* Safari 和 Chrome */
  -o-transform:rotate(-2deg);}
